There was a prayer of intercession, or, as it is called in knoxs liturgy, a prayer for the whole estate of christs church. Here the church prays for the ministry of the word, for the faithfulness of church officers, for the perfection of the saints, for the salvation of all people, for the deliverance of the afflicted, and, as paul.
